Transaction 5c70d8fec2df9986d7662376c98f4479893ec031d59817a4e8139defbcd16f13

2 Input
1 Outputs
  • 5c70d8fec2df9986d7662376c98f4479893ec031d59817a4e8139defbcd16f13:0
  • value  799385
    address  33smJm6e3P9ZG9HkxEZnK2ngg5Fmjg1ARj